Spread the bread evenly into the bottom of a greased 9×13 inch baking dish. 2. Sprinkle the sausage and cheese evenly over the bread. 3. In a large measuring cup, combine the eggs, milk, dry mustard, salt and pepper. 4. Pour the egg mixture evenly over the ingredients in the pan. 5. Cover and chill overnight.

This sausage egg casserole is very simple to make! Place bread cubes, chopped peppers and cooked sausage in a casserole dish (per recipe below). Combine eggs, milk and cheese. Pour over bread. Refrigerate at least 4 hours (overnight is best). This allows the bread cubes to soak up the egg mixture. In the morning just bake and serve!

Grease a deep 13 x 9-inch baking dish. Arrange bread cubes in the bottom of the dish. Add the sausage on top, followed by the cheese. In a large bowl, whisk together eggs, milk, dry mustard, kosher salt and pepper. Pour egg mixture over the casserole. Cover tightly with foil and refrigerate for 8 hours (or overnight).
